Dimensions

The layout of the dressing room with small ones with dimensions of 1.5 x 1.5 meters is a rather modest option. A smaller size will make it difficult to move and create discomfort. But the reality is that many people live in small-sized houses of the old layout, where space for a wardrobe can only be allocated in a pantry 1.2 x 1.5 meters.

And the best solution is a room 2 x 2 meters. If the space of the room allows, then the area can be increased.


Types of layouts

There are several basic types of dressing rooms, the layout with dimensions of which depends on the placement of doors and windows, as well as on the special preferences of the owners. Each species has characteristic features that make it suitable for a particular type of room.

Linear

Linear is similar to a regular wardrobe, only without doors, without division into zones and the usual furniture filling. This option is perfect for an elongated room along a blank wall. But it can be placed around the doorway.


Parallel

A parallel dressing room is the best option for elongated rooms and corridor-type rooms. Hangers and shelves are located along the free walls opposite each other. A window or a large mirror is opposite the door. The presence of a window solves the problem of ventilation of the room and fills the room with daylight.


U-shaped

To create a U-shaped room, three walls are used, so this type of layout is considered the most convenient. This option is especially good when arranging large dressing rooms, where the central wall should be at least 1.5 meters in length. There is enough space for an ironing board, and for a mirror, and for a chair. Clothes rails in two tiers, boxes, racks, shelves, drawers - here you can place everything for storage.


L-shaped

One side of the L-shaped dressing room is the entrance. Adjacent walls form a corner, and the third side is the entrance. The fourth wall is optional. Furniture can be placed there: for example, shelving with closed back walls.


corner

Cabinets with shelves and rods are installed along two adjacent walls. A mirror or a vertical hanger can stand in the corner. The third side is a screen or sliding compartment doors, standard or semicircular (radius). Such a dressing room is good in the bedroom, where the bed stands as a headboard to the screen-partition.

This option is effective in rooms with limited space, as storage systems at an angle of 90 ° allow you to store twice as much things as in a conventional linear cabinet.

Internal content rules

Choosing furniture for a mini-dressing room is especially careful, since ergonomics are important in this room. It is necessary to carefully consider the required number of compartments for various types of clothing, as well as their size.

There are two types of storage systems:

  • stationary - place finished furniture;
  • rod - rods and guides are attached to the walls, ceiling and floor, then shelves are installed on them.

The best idea is cabinets or shelving up to the ceiling without doors with compartments of different sizes. For shoes, folded things and outerwear, a suitable width and height are selected.

Drawers with a bottom are suitable for storing underwear, gloves, and with crossbars - for trousers and scarves.

For coats and jackets, a height of 0.5-1.2 meters is sufficient. For outerwear and dresses, you need 1.5-1.8 meters. It is reasonable to arrange these departments one above the other. The top row can be lowered with a pantograph.

The optimal size of the shelves is 30-35 cm. The depth of the cabinets is calculated based on the width of the shoulders, and can vary from 50 to 70 cm.

For bags, shelves or a vertical hanger with hooks arranged in a spiral are suitable.

For shoes - crossbars or shelves, for folded clothes - also shelves.

To store seasonal items, suitcases, voluminous bed linen, use the upper part of the dressing room. Above eye level - shelves for hats, umbrellas and bags. At the very bottom there are nets and boxes with shoes. It is convenient to store shoes at an inclination of 45-60 ° or in rotating radial structures.

How to make a dressing room in a small room - design projects, photos

If you still have doubts about how to make a dressing room in a small room (photo below) in a small apartment, then your living space is not well understood. A dressing room in a small area can be done in three ways:


A few words should be said about the dimensions;

  1. The area of ​​the selected premises must be at least 3.5, but not more than 8 m2.
  2. Determine the distance from the cabinet or shelves to the opposite wall - it must be at least 1.5 m.
  3. To place things comfortably on the shelves, their depth should be no less than 50 cm.
  4. The height between the shelves should be up to 40 cm.
  5. If the shelves are attached directly to the wall, you need to alternate rows of them with spans for the clothes that you will hang. Recommended length - 80 cm.

Wardrobe room: layout, photo or how many tiers to create in the layout?

Since a large number of various things are often stored in the dressing room, tiering for a room with a similar purpose will be the most preferable option.


Please note that without a competent layout, the dressing room (photo below) will not work. Initially, you need to divide the room into four zones:

  • outerwear area (it should be 0.5 meters deep and 1.5 meters high - so things will be placed in it quite freely);
  • zone for short clothes (should be about 0.5 meters by 1 meter - wardrobe items such as shirts and skirts will be stored there;
  • area for shoes (the module should not be too low - you may have to place several tiers of boxes);
  • dressing area (preferably equipped with a large mirror).

Rules for a successful dressing room

If there is an unused corner of a sufficient area in a house or apartment, it is quite possible to make a full-fledged dressing room in it. A pantry or attic is perfect for this role, it is enough to install a partition and equip shelves. Any dressing room must obey the following rules.

  1. The size is at least 1 * 1.5 m. In a tighter dressing room it will not be possible to install shelves or it will not be possible to enter it, which will significantly reduce functionality.
  2. To make the room comfortable, you should take care of installing a mirror. This will facilitate and speed up the daily preparation of a successful outfit.
  3. You need to take care of ventilation. If the natural one is not enough, it is worth installing a forced one. Otherwise, the musty smell will haunt you constantly.
  4. If there is no window in the corner in which it was decided to make a dressing room, sufficient lighting must also be provided.
  5. The most successful door to the dressing room is a compartment. She will not eat up the already limited space. In addition, due to its features, it will provide an influx of fresh air. Yes, and decorating such a door is easier than a swing door.
  6. Be sure to plan the internal structure in advance. This will take into account all the features and preferences of the owner of the new dressing room.

Planning

The dressing room is a closet that you can enter. It is from this rule that you should build on if you decide to make it yourself. First of all, you need to draw a plan for the future storage corner, taking into account preferences and some rules. The correct internal arrangement of the dressing room will save a lot of space. What rules should be considered when planning a new closet or wardrobe?

  1. The height of the compartment for thick outerwear is from 150 cm.
  2. Office for light outerwear - from 100 cm.
  3. The height of the shelves for shoes - according to the height of the most voluminous box + 10 cm.
  4. The height of the shelves for basic items is chosen individually, but usually not higher than 40-45 cm. It is extremely difficult to store trousers and sweaters neatly on higher shelves. It is better to make more shelves.
  5. The width of each compartment, of course, the larger the better, but an approximate stock can also be calculated by inspecting your clothing stocks.
  6. You should not make shelves without a minimum margin in height and width. Free space is necessary for ventilation.
  7. It is better to make a choice in favor of quantity. It is more convenient to store a thing folded in several units. Tall stacks will inevitably shift, creating a mess.
  8. Some items, such as socks and underwear, are best stored in well-ventilated drawers or baskets.
  9. For frequently used wardrobe items, shelves should be at chest level or slightly lower.
  10. Removable shelves are excellent. Their installation will allow you to change the design of the wardrobe without global alterations.

Before you start making a dressing room with your own hands, you need to approve the final plan. This will allow you to accurately calculate the consumption of material and avoid rework.
